jaybee55

Cache bloat can slow down the startup time, but usually by seconds (maybe 20-30 at worst), not minutes.

What version of Firefox do you have?  What version of Windows are you running?  How much RAM do you have?

Here's a simple test to see if its a RAM problem: Make sure you close all applications.  Start Firefox.  Does it still take forever?  If not you probably need more RAM.  (caveat: If you are running Windows 7 with < 2gb of RAM you might have issues no matter what you do).

jaybee55

Personally I'm amazed that FF11 runs on win98 at all.  Wow!  And since you're running win98 you're stuck with IE6 as an alternative... wow :(

I'm fairly certain you can still get a "legacy" version of Opera that will run on win98.  Maybe that's a viable alternative?

Did you try any of the official fixes suggested by the link I sent?

My gut feeling is still that you're having a memory problem, and that the interminable delays are probably a result of thrashing.  So, when you say you have "plenty of RAM" can you be a little more specific?  Of course that might be a moot point: Windows 98 has a flaw that causes all but the top 512mb (of a maximum 2gb) to be nearly unusable - it gets allocated to disk cache instead of process space.  Modern versions of Firefox (with a half-dozen tabs open) can easily use that much RAM all by itself.

Oreo

#13
Yes, if you can get on long enough. Click your bookmarks. Choose 'organize bookmarks'. Then Export Bookmarks. When I do it, it saves it to my pictures. Then when you get reloaded you can Import them from the saved cache. You may not need to do that unless you are moving to a different computer though. Firefox should have them stored even if you try another version. I use an older one, 3.6.2, I think.

Sorry, edit: To change your homepage. Open E, then click Tools --> options --> general. The option to make E your homepage is there.
